Shishimai Festivals:

Hachioji City is proud to have several Shishimai traditions recognized as designated intangible folk cultural properties. These captivating performances, characterized by the elaborate costumes and dynamic movements of the lion dancers, are typically performed during local festivals and shrine events to ward off evil spirits and bring good fortune.

Kiyariki Performances:

The “Kiyariki,” a distinctive form of chanting and rhythmic movement, is another cherished intangible folk cultural property of Hachioji City. Historically, Kiyariki was performed by workers, often in connection with construction or heavy labor, to synchronize efforts and maintain morale through powerful vocalizations and coordinated movements. Today, it is performed in various community events and celebrations, showcasing the strength and unity of the participants.
